Well, Faith's always a sticky issue when it comes to this ship. That's because the ONLY thing we can point to in canon where Buffy's
sexuality is genuinely in question is her relationship with Faith
through seasons 3 and 4.  Then, of course, there's Willow's reaction
to it (She was still complaining about the "cleavagy slutbomb" to
Tara, who was too polite to press her about it, just as Joyce never
pressed Buffy about why Faith was ranting like an obsessed
ex-girlfriend in the same episode). This was the subtext that was intentionally written into the series. If you say that subtext meant nothing, then we're left, in canon, with
a completely hetero Buffy who never has romantic feelings for women,
at all, including a certain redhead.  We're left with a Willow who's
just concerned for a friend, not reacting to another woman intruding
on what's subconciously (at the time, at least)her territory.
We also know that Willow does get territorial even if she's involved
with someone else, at the time.
"I'm not the most objective, I know. I kind of have an issue with
Faith sharing my people." - Willow, "Consequences"

Her people, in this case, were Buffy and Xander.  We saw, earlier in
that episode, how Willow reacted, broken hearted and crying, when she
found out Xander had slept with Faith, this WHILE she was supposedly
in love with, and completely devoted to, Oz.  She also happened to be
broken hearted and near tears in the previous episode, "Bad Girls",
over someone Faith was with that had nothing to DO with Xander.  This
is a pattern.  Willow was the EXACT same way in Season 2 with
Cordelia.  She freaked out at Xander when she caught him kissing Cordy
(again, while she was involved with Oz), and had the previously
mentioned "Ye gods" scene with Buffy in Reptile Boy (And Buffy wasn't
even BEING subtexty about Cordy, but Willow REACTED like she was).

Buffy being subtexty with girls in canon, and Willow responding in the
exact same territorial way she did when Xander, who it was long
established Willow was crushing on, had girlfriends does NOT hurt the
Wiffy ship.  It does anything but.  It gives us something in canon to
establish that, yes, women ARE an option for Buffy, and Willow has
more than friendship feelings for her.
